The story of Allan Nebeker Adams began in 1912 in Logan, Cache County, Utah, United States of America. In 1920, Allan Nebeker Adams resided in Logan, Cache, Utah, USA. In 1930, Allan Nebeker Adams resided in Salt Lake City, Salt Lake, Utah, USA. Allan Nebeker Adams married Helen Mabey, and had children including Luella Jane Adams, Margaret Adams, Nancy Adams, Robert Allan Adams, William Allan Adams. Allan Nebeker Adams passed away in 1996 in Providence, Cache County, Utah, United States of America.
